Omri Casspi apologizes to girl he crashed into with 'Frozen' doll

Israeli-born Sacramento Kings offers young girl a special gift after tumbling into her during NBA game. 'Had to make sure she’s not mad at me,' he says.

One of the luxuries of sitting courtside at an NBA game is the chance that one of the basketball league's finest will come tumbling into you, usually due to a hard foul on the opposing team.

 

 

Sure, it might be a minute or two of discomfort, and you may want to wash off the inevitable beads of sweat that landed on you, but think of what a great story you could have at cocktail parties.

 

"I'm telling you, Lebron James crashed right into me! He CHOSE me!"

 

But if you're a young girl who likely knows little about the sport, the incident certainly seems way less appealing.

 

That's why after Israeli NBA star for the Sacramento Kings, Omri Casspi, crashed into a young girl sitting courtside beside her parents, he felt pretty awful about it.

  

 

The event took place on Sunday during a home game against the Washington Wizards, when the team's Paul Pierce pushed Casspi, who inadvertently fell into the crowd, and subsequently, the young girl, who immediately burst into tears.

Refs gave Pierce a flagrant foul for the shove, and the Wizards lost by 23 points to the Kings. But Casspi, being the mensch that he is, later showed up at the family's house to offer her an apology, and a gift: A doll from the highly popular animated musical, "Frozen."

 

"Had to make sure she’s not mad at me after I crashed at her during the game… and what’s a better gift than princess Elsa and Ulaf from #Frozen," Casspi posted on his Facebook page Tuesday, accompanied by a photo of him and the girl.

 

Meanwhile, Casspi has been having a pretty solid season this year, one of his finest since joining the NBA as Israel's first professional basketball player back in 2009.
